As a Part-time Registered Practical Nurse your duties and responsibilities would include, but are not limited to;
-Administering of medication according to doctor's orders.
-Processing orders.
-Working with pharmacies to fill prescriptions and answer questions that arise.
-Using your knowledge and skills to assess residents care needs with the practical judgement and competencies you have gained according to the standards set by the College of Nurses of Ontario.
-Documenting resident care throughout your shift and giving a full report to the next oncoming Healthcare staff member.
-Support the healthcare staff including the Healthcare Manager, Unregulated Care Providers and Personal Support Workers
-Record weights and blood pressures monthly
-Respond to resident and family member calls, questions or concerns
-Monitor activity in the building while on shift to ensure the resident wellbeing is top of mind
-Handling emergency situations when they arise
